Differences emerge in PF over mode of selecting candidate

Differences have emerged over mode of selection of the Patriotic Front presidential candidate ahead of the forthcoming Presidential by-election with some senior PF members rejecting the selection of the candidate by the Central Committee.

PF Secretary General Edgar Lungu yesterday hinted in a media statement that the Central Committee will select the PF presidential candidate and not the general conference as stipulated in the party constitution.

Mr Lungu stated that this is considering that party has little time to organize the general conference.
But PF Youth Chairman Chishimba Kambwili has told QFM News in an interview that there will be no shortcuts in selecting the party’s presidential candidate.

Mr. Kambwili says such suggestions will not be tolerated, stating that the party has a valid constitution which must be followed.
And Patriotic Front Chairperson for Mining and Mineral Development Wilbur Simuusa has told Journalists in Lusaka that the party will ensure it selects a candidate who the people want and not imposed on them by some individuals with hidden agendas.
Meanwhile, Kantanshi PF Member of Parliament, Yamfwa Mukanga, has told QFM News in a separate interview that it is worrying that some PF members are busy talking about succession when the founder of the party has not yet been buried.
Mr. Mukanga, who is also Transport, Works, Supply and Communications Minister, is also of the view that the Central Committee should select the PF candidate ahead of the presidential by-election.
And PF Secretary General Edgar Lungu has told Journalists in Lusaka that if the party allows corrupt individuals to take up the presidency, the whole country will be polluted.
Mr. Lungu says there is need for the PF to choose a candidate who will build on the legacy left by President Sata.
